Solvophobicity-directed assembly of microporous molecular crystals
Porous organic crystals can be challenging to prepare, because in the absence of guests, they often collapse into denser, non-porous polymorphs. Here the formation of porous and non-porous polymorphs in different solvents is shown to depend on a solvophobic effect driven by dispersion interactions.
